summaryrefslogtreecommitdiff
path: root/dotfiles/.emacs.d
diff options
context:
space:
mode:
Diffstat (limited to 'dotfiles/.emacs.d')
-rw-r--r--dotfiles/.emacs.d/init.el31
1 files changed, 0 insertions, 31 deletions
diff --git a/dotfiles/.emacs.d/init.el b/dotfiles/.emacs.d/init.el
index 39d2c40..30c284c 100644
--- a/dotfiles/.emacs.d/init.el
+++ b/dotfiles/.emacs.d/init.el
@@ -35,37 +35,6 @@
(when-require 'guix-init
(setf guix-dot-program (concat (getenv "HOME") "/.guix-profile/bin/dot")))
-(require 'package)
-(add-to-list 'package-archives
- '("melpa" . "http://melpa.milkbox.net/packages/") t)
-(package-initialize)
-
-;; Additional packages that I use.
-(setf required-packages
- '(better-defaults
- elfeed
- emms
- ido-ubiquitous
- js2-mode
- notmuch-unread
- rainbow-delimiters
- smex
- web-mode
- projectile
- markdown-mode
- yaml-mode
- glsl-mode))
-
-(defun install-missing-packages ()
- "Install all required packages that haven't been installed."
- (interactive)
- (package-refresh-contents)
- (mapc (lambda (package)
- (unless (package-installed-p package)
- (package-install package)))
- required-packages)
- (message "Installed all missing packages!"))
-
;;;
;;; Look and Feel
;;;